Output 590cf43c544ae7edd7734fa278bd73398e25330445dba6ebc8b69f1d4a0c059c:23

value
8106034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8c71545ae08af7d4c0ed399fb1d852e8f41684 OP_EQUAL
address
3Mht9gdK98YV1mY2ENottVjbESL63J15zu
transaction
590cf43c544ae7edd7734fa278bd73398e25330445dba6ebc8b69f1d4a0c059c
confirmations
290270
spent
true